Ducati – The adventurous journey of the twenty-two-year-old Briton left London on April 3rd Henry Crew, who will attempt to travel 35.000 miles on a Desert Sled Scrambler, crossing 35 countries and six continents, with the aim of entering the Guinness World Record as the youngest motorcyclist to cross the world solo.

Traveler but also ambassador and of a message of solidarity, this adventure will serve to raise funds and promote the work of the Movember Foundation. After losing three friends to suicide and experiencing health problems first-hand, Henry decided to raise £35.000 (£1 for every mile) for the Foundation which supports global research and support programs in the fields of cancer prostate, testicular cancer, men's mental health and suicide prevention. The exciting motorcycling initiative of the very young Henry, which is expected to last approximately 13 months, started from Bike Shed Motorcycle Club of Shoreditch, London, Tuesday 3 April 2018. The first stop on the long journey was the Ducati factory in Borgo Panigale, where he received a warm welcome from the entire company. “I've been planning the trip for eight months and I don't think there could be a better partner than Movember to support and stimulate me in this endeavor – declared Henry -. Not only have they created a large community in contact with the motorcycling world, but they also fight for the causes that are close to my heart, such as prevention and attention to the problems linked to the many suicides which, unfortunately, are a terrible plague involving many young people around the world“. Henry rides a Scrambler Desert Sled made available by Ducati UK who, after hearing the story of the young centaur and the purpose of the journey, enthusiastically agreed to take on this adventurous challenge.

The countries that will be crossed are United Kingdom, France, Italy, Germany, Austria, Hungary, Romania, Moldova, Ukraine, Russia, Kazakhstan, Turkmenistan, Iran, Pakistan, India, Bangladesh, India, Myanmar (Burma), Thailand, Malaysia, Australia (Perth – Brisbane), Chile, Peru, Ecuador, Panama, Costa Rica, Nicaragua, Honduras, Guatemala. To break the world record, Henry will have to return to the UK by Friday 10 May 2019, no easy feat but the courage and determination of this young Englishman will only be rewarded.
